Output e5c5d32b1226b6d7daa2ea091d81cda952485c07f9bb4c93e1eec6725d6036de:0

value
355615
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c28b1181c4a55170c8099f40ca3890ae8eb2b2cd OP_EQUAL
address
3KRfcQ8y4zX2avqxeUW5sA8u9mh5T55ndv
transaction
e5c5d32b1226b6d7daa2ea091d81cda952485c07f9bb4c93e1eec6725d6036de
spent
true